PackageDescriptionExim MTA (v4) daemon with minimal hard dependencies Exim (v4) is a mail transport agent. This package contains the exim4 daemon with extended features, most built as dlopened modules for minimal hard dependencies. In addition to the features already supported by exim4-daemon-light, exim4-daemon-mod includes LDAP, PostgreSQL and MariaDB/MySQL data lookups, SASL and SPA SMTP authentication, embedded Perl interpreter, and the content scanning extension (formerly known as "exiscan-acl") for integration of virus scanners and spamassassin. It does not support dlopened local_scan modules like sa-exim. . The Debian exim4 packages have their own web page, http://wiki.debian.org/PkgExim4. There is also a Debian-specific FAQ list. Information about the way the Debian packages are configured can be found in /usr/share/doc/exim4-base/README.Debian.gz, which additionally contains information about the way the Debian binary packages are built. The very extensive upstream documentation is shipped in /usr/share/doc/exim4-base/spec.txt.gz. To repeat the debconf-driven configuration process in a standard setup, invoke dpkg-reconfigure exim4-config. There is a Debian-centered mailing list, pkg-exim4-users@lists.alioth.debian.org.
